Johnathon Longstreth Obituary (1998 – 2021) – Washington, PA
Johnathon Ray “John” Longstreth, 23, of Washington, passed away suddenly on Friday, October 29, 2021.
He was born on September 11, 1998 in Washington, son of Stephen L. “Steve” Longstreth and Marian T. Kudla Longstreth, of Washington.
John graduated from McGuffey High School in 2017 with a degree in corporate finance from Slippery Rock University.
He attended the Abundant Life Baptist Church.
John had worked at Bell’s Landscaping in Canonsburg and had recently started working as a representative in Washington at ADT Security.
A young man who enjoyed spending time with his friends, John enjoyed hunting, fishing, watching movies, playing video games, working outdoors, and landscaping.
Survivor, in addition to his parents, are his maternal grandparents, Donald and Anna Kudla, of Bridgeport, W.Va .; paternal grandparents, Joseph William and Mary Lucille Longstreth, of Washington; one sister, Amanda Marie Longstreth, of Washington; one brother, Joseph Anthony Longstreth, of Washington; aunts and uncles, Terri and Anthony Centofanti, of Charleston, WV, Mary Beth and Jay Hill, of Imperial, and Kim and Mike Clark, of Claysville; and his cousins, Vincent (Auri) Centofanti, and their daughter Viena, Dominick Centofanti, Christina Centofanti, Shane (Carly) Hill, Alexis Hill, Ethan Clark and Emma Clark.
